X-Git-Url: http://v3vee.org/palacios/gitweb/gitweb.cgi?a=blobdiff_plain;f=palacios%2Fsrc%2Fpalacios%2Fvmm_intr.c;h=1397c075e0f86bfee9878addb017c997cea0cc56;hb=d962f2be029772be3f21d9bd206ddf2a9f6a1d20;hp=87b6802a5313448dcc61bc27fa97ec50d5fac72a;hpb=7650d345982514b32fc0f116b8a6512ec243b267;p=palacios.git diff --git a/palacios/src/palacios/vmm_intr.c b/palacios/src/palacios/vmm_intr.c index 87b6802..1397c07 100644 --- a/palacios/src/palacios/vmm_intr.c +++ b/palacios/src/palacios/vmm_intr.c @@ -228,6 +228,13 @@ int v3_raise_irq(struct v3_vm_info * vm, int irq) { } +void v3_clear_pending_intr(struct guest_info * core) { + struct v3_intr_core_state * intr_state = &(core->intr_core_state); + + intr_state->irq_pending = 0; + +} + v3_intr_type_t v3_intr_pending(struct guest_info * info) { struct v3_intr_core_state * intr_state = &(info->intr_core_state);